What is Fingerprint Payment?

Fingerprint payment is a type of biometric payment authentication system. It uses fingerprint recognition technology to verify the identity of a user before authorizing a payment. This method typically involves a fingerprint sensor, which scans and matches the unique ridges and patterns of a user’s finger to pre-stored biometric data.

Once the match is confirmed, the transaction proceeds—making it both secure and seamless.

How Does It Work?

Fingerprint payment systems are integrated into various platforms such as:

  • Smartphones: Mobile payment apps like Apple Pay, Google Pay, and Samsung Pay allow users to authorize transactions using fingerprint sensors.
  • Point of Sale (POS) Devices: Some merchants are equipping POS terminals with fingerprint scanners for biometric payments.
  • Biometric Payment Cards: These are advanced credit or debit cards with built-in fingerprint sensors. Users authenticate payments by simply placing their finger on the card sensor.

Advantages of Fingerprint Payment

  1. Enhanced Security: Fingerprints are unique and nearly impossible to replicate, reducing the risk of fraud or identity theft.
  2. Faster Transactions: Biometric verification is typically quicker than entering PINs or passwords.
  3. No Need for Cards or Cash: Users can leave their wallets at home and pay using only their fingerprint.
  4. User Convenience: Forgetting passwords or losing cards becomes a non-issue.
  5. Reduced Human Error: Biometric authentication minimizes errors caused by manual input.

Challenges and Considerations

Despite its benefits, fingerprint payment technology comes with certain challenges:

  • Privacy Concerns: Storing and handling biometric data raises questions about user privacy and data protection.
  • Device Compatibility: Not all devices or POS systems support fingerprint scanning.
  • Environmental Factors: Fingerprint scanners may not work properly if the user’s finger is wet, dirty, or injured.
  • Cost: Implementing biometric systems can be expensive for merchants and financial institutions.

Applications and Use Cases

Fingerprint payment is being used across various sectors, including:

  • Retail: Stores offer quick checkouts through biometric POS systems.
  • Banking: Some ATMs now allow fingerprint-based withdrawals.
  • Public Transportation: Certain transit systems are piloting biometric fare payment.
  • Online Shopping: E-commerce platforms are incorporating fingerprint verification for purchases.

The Future of Fingerprint Payments

As technology continues to advance, fingerprint payments are expected to become more widespread. With growing concerns about cybersecurity, the demand for secure and user-friendly authentication methods will only increase. Innovations like multi-modal biometrics—combining fingerprints with facial or iris recognition—are likely to further enhance reliability.

Furthermore, as adoption grows and infrastructure improves, fingerprint payments could become the norm for millions of users worldwide.
